What the Heck is Nonwoven Geotextile?

So, you might be wondering, “What’s this fancy term all about?” In simple terms, nonwoven geotextiles are textile materials that don’t have a woven structure. Instead, they’re made from layers of synthetic fibers that are bonded together. You can think of them as fabric superhero capes for erosion control. They’re light, flexible, and designed specifically to filter out sediment. Pretty neat, right?

Filtering Out Sediment: The Primary Purpose

Now that we know what these materials are, let’s dive into their main job—filtering out sediment. You see, when it rains, stormwater picks up soil, debris, and pollution, transporting it directly to our stormwater inlets. Ugh! What a mess! This is where our nonwoven geotextiles come to the rescue.

As water flows through the geotextile fabric, it encounters a unique structure that allows the liquid to pass while trapping larger sediment particles. Why Does This Matter?

You might be asking, “Why should I care about sediment in the first place?” Good question! Maintaining clean waterways is crucial for a variety of reasons:

  • Water Quality: Excess sediment can carry pollutants that degrade water quality, affecting local ecosystems and potentially making water unsafe for recreational use.

  • Flood Prevention: Clogged storm drains can lead to localized flooding during heavy rains. Nonwoven geotextiles help reduce the likelihood of blockages, keeping our urban spaces safe and dry.

  • Cost-Efficiency: Preventing sediment buildup means less maintenance for stormwater infrastructure. This can save municipalities a pretty penny in maintenance and repair costs.

Common Misconceptions

Now that we’ve established the importance of filtering out sediment, let’s clear up a few misconceptions about nonwoven geotextiles. Sometimes, folks confuse these materials with others designed for different purposes. For example, you might think nonwoven geotextiles can hold back large debris or support heavy structures. Not exactly!

While those functions might be important elsewhere, nonwoven geotextiles truly shine at filtration—keeping the good water flowing and stopping the bad sediment dead in its tracks. They’re not your heavy-duty construction materials but rather the finesse players in water management.
